Bakery and dairy products maker Britannia Industries Ltd is planning to expand manufacturing capacity in bakery products by setting up one or two new plants, a top official said on Friday."We are enhancing capacity in our existing plants and it is quite likely in this year we may look at 1-2 greenfield projects..it will be in bakery products," Vinita Bali, managing director, told Reuters. The firm has earmarked a capital expenditure of 700-800 million rupees in FY11 for the expansion, Bali added.The firm late on Thursday posted a 32 percent drop in net profit to 1.03 billion rupees and saw a modest 10 percent growth to 37.7 billion rupees in FY10 from the same period a year earlier.(Reporting by Nandita Bose; Editing by Sunil Nair)(For more business news on Reuters India click http://in.reuters.com)
